Claude Alexander Conlin (June 30, 1880 – August 5, 1954), known as Alexander the Man Who Knows, was a spiritual author, and vaudeville magician who began performing in 1915. He dressed in Oriental style robes and a feathered turban, often using a crystal ball as a prop, and specialized in mentalism and psychic reading acts. His successful performances made him a wealthy man, but he also had another side to his life, with a significant FBI dossier that suspected him of murder, money laundering, grand larceny, fraud, and drug smuggling. His personal life was just as wild with as many as 14 marriages – many simultaneously – and throughout all of them, he was a serial adulterer that leveraged his popularity to the fullest with countless women.
